GitHub2Synology
A simple Ash (practically "BusyBox bash") script designed to run on the Synology DS range of file storage servers to backup all repositories (and wikis) for a user from Github.
Install
-
Ensure you have
git
installed on the Synology - this can be download from the SynoCommunity. The script also needs cUrl and jq but these seem standard on Synologys. -
Now login to Github and go to https://github.com/settings/tokens and create a personal access token with the following scopes:
- repo (repo itself including all subs) - Full control of private repositories
- admin:org read:org - Read org and team membership
-
Add this token as the OAUTH_TOKEN in line 7 on the
github2synology.sh
script. (OAUTH_TOKEN="[PUT YOUR TOKEN HERE BETWEEN THE QUOTES]"
) -
Ensure the backup path is correct on line 9. (
BACKUP_PATH="/volume1/serverBackups/github/backup"
) -
Copy the script over to your Synology and run it (all via SSH)
